It is extremely evident to those who view Bokrosh's sculptures that they not only inspire but initiate conversation. Each piece invites viewers to experience the world through the lens of one who possesses a deep love for the craft. "Mergingold," one of his most striking works, attests to this.

"Mergingold" commands attention with its sheer size and exquisite craftsmanship, with dimensions of 33 cm in width and 28 cm in depth. It towers at 183 cm and weighs 544 kg. The rotating sculpture rests on top of a sturdy basalt stone base. It has six inset roller bearings to ensure that it can be admired and cherished to its fullest extent wherever it graces.

This monumental piece of transparent gold optical glass, which looks like a colossal diamond with its gleaming radiant brilliance, was meticulously cut and polished through the years. It is infused with a cerium oxide that radiates a deep transparent gold hue that is bound to mesmerize the viewer. What makes the sculpture even more magical is its personality and ability to transform when under either natural or artificial light. "Mergingold" comes alive when basked in direct sunlight, casting vibrant colored hues and completely changing the atmosphere of the space it inhabits as it slowly rotates one revolution per hour!

When asked about the sculpting process of this extraordinary masterpiece, Bokrosh recounts, "It definitely wasn't easy. It took several years of dedication and experimentation. But it was all worth it as it became the initial work in my Monumental Glass Series."
